Iron Fish Distillery's Soft Parade Vodka

Bottoms Up
By Anna Faller | June 1, 2024

There’s something about a fruity cocktail that screams “summer,” and the 2024 batch of Iron Fish Distillery’s Soft Parade Vodka has us hollering from the rooftops! Crafted in collaboration with Short’s Brewing Company in Bellaire, this local little number combines an even split of wheat and rye vodkas (that’s the same grain mash as the beer) cold-infused with the concentrated juices of Michigan blueberries, blackberries, strawberries, and raspberries. Brambly, balanced, and oh-so-pink, this juicy spirit is great with a mixer—try lemonade and thank us later—or in a refreshing cocktail, like the distillery’s Soft Parade Basil Martini. Top it off with a spicy snack, and consider the heat sufficiently beat.
